Courtney Dye Is Off The Ventilator

Courtney Dye remains in a coma, but she's now breathing almost completely on her own.

"Courtney is now off the ventilator except for two short periods during the day when she is connected to it again to be sure her lungs expand completely and that she gets a bit of extra oxygen. She opens her eyes slightly, but without recognition at this time," reported Lendon Gray.

Jason Dye, Courtney's husband is also continuing to keep people updated on Courtney’s website. He  thanked everyone for sending so many cards and messages of support.

“Her room is filling up with wonderful cards and photos, and she has a beautiful canvas print hanging at the foot of her bed. It is of her and Mythilus at the 2008 Olympics with the rings and flame in the background. The nurses all admire it and are using it as inspiration to give her the best care possible. They want to be able to watch her at the 2012 Games and point at the television and say that they knew her and cared for her!”
